5.8S-28S rRNA interaction and HMM-based ITS2 annotation
Gene, 2009The internal transcribed spacer 2 (ITS2) of the nuclear ribosomal repeat unit is one of the most commonly applied phylogenetic markers. It is a fast evolving locus, which makes it appropriate for studies at low taxonomic levels, whereas its secondary structure is well conserved, and tree reconstructions are possible at higher taxonomic levels. ITS2 is a double-edged tool for eukaryote evolutionary comparisons
Trends in Genetics, 2003Abstract The internal transcribed spacer (ITS) region of the nuclear rDNA cistrons is one of the more frequently utilized regions for phylogenetic analyses at the genus and species levels. It has proven valuable for phylogenetic reconstruction of species and genus relationships, using comparisons of primary sequence.
